## Onboarding: Transcodia farm access

Transcodia is our video transcoding farm; jobs are submitted through the dispatch queue and picked up by worker nodes in the Bellmarsh cluster. To run a local worker against staging, create `.env.worker` from the template in the repo. Set `TRANSCODIA_QUEUE=staging-jobs` and `WORKER_SLOTS=4`. Workers authenticate to the dispatch queue with a node credential issued by the platform team, so place that credential on the line directly after the queue setting.

env line for yahip-tafog: RELAY_SECRET3=4ca

## Migration Step 4 — ContrastCheck v3

Reviewer notes: the audit now enforces WCAG-AA ratios at build time instead of post-deploy scans. Reject any PR that suppresses a contrast rule without a linked ticket. Token overrides move from the theme package to the audit manifest; the old `palette-exceptions.json` is ignored entirely. Run the new scanner locally before approving — it catches hover-state regressions the old one missed. Confirm the manifest in the PR matches the expected configuration values.

settings of tagef-bawif:
DRUIX_HOST=druix.zemvarlabs.internal
DRUIX_PORT=8000

## Deployment

tailwhip is the internal CLI used to tail logs from Querrel services. Builds are produced by the packaging job and pushed to the internal artifact mirror; maintainers should never hand-copy binaries onto hosts. Deployment is a single rsync step followed by a symlink flip, so rollback is just re-pointing the symlink. Before the first run on a fresh host, confirm the daemon picks up the expected settings.

service settings:
ralwyn:
  log_level: error
  metrics_host: metrics.ralwyn.tolvaqsys.internal
  pin: 9545
  pool_size: 8

Management Meeting Minutes — Quarterly Cash-Flow Forecast

Attendees: J. Velmar, T. Osric, P. Landelle. The Q4 forecast shows a modest surplus, contingent on timely receivables from the Ardenfield accounts. Osric noted capex for the Solvine upgrade may slip to Q1. Agreed: finance to stress-test the forecast against a 10% collections shortfall and circulate revised figures Monday. Forward-looking details are recorded confidentially below.

board note of hahaf-fahog: The pricing group signed off on a budget of $229.3 million for Project Aldius.